Decontamination Technician at Gloucestershire Health and Care NHS Foundation Trust

The closing date for this role is 09 October 2025. This position is offered on a fixed-term/secondment basis for 9 months.

Job Purpose

The job purpose for this role is to provide specialized decontamination services to the Gloucestershire Health and Care NHS Foundation Trust Community Dental Clinic, employing specialized decontamination equipment and pressurized vessels to ensure used medical equipment and instruments are cleaned, sterilized, and repackaged.

Responsibilities
  • To manually clean dental instruments and equipment as required to manufacturers' guidelines, safely use an ultra-sonic bath, and use an automated washer disinfector effectively.
  • To liaise with outside stakeholders to ensure a quality service.
  • Be proactive in problem-solving when equipment fails and be confident and competent when reporting any non-conformance.
  • To disinfect laboratory work going to and from the lab according to the SOP.
  • To report when stock levels are getting low and maintain good stock control.
  • To check that dental instruments and equipment in store are within the acceptable HTM 01-05 timeframe guidelines and reprocess non-compliant items.
  • To document all daily testing and maintenance of machines and equipment as required.
  • Comply with the highest standards required for daily documentation of all equipment.
